My Soul...as a weaned child

What a wonderful Psalm of praise and thanksgiving for the good grace of God. David proclaims by his rejoicing, that humbly he has walked before Him.
In these 3 short verses, David says much about his relationship and fellowship with Him who is invisible. In so doing, there is no wonder he is deemed "the sweet psalmist".
Verse 1 describes David's Contentment. He says my eyes need not wander anywhere than where I am. If this green pasture is my calling, then happy I shall be!
Verse 2 gives us David's Confidence. I hvae quieted myself and "as a child that is weaned of his mother" my soul is sanctified from worldly things.
Finally, verse 3 gives David's Consignment of himself as well as all Isreal to hope in the Lord.
